fp-int-convert-timode.c

来自「用于进行gcc测试」· C语言 代码 · 共 22 行

C
22
字号
/* Test floating-point conversions.  TImode types.  *//* Origin: Joseph Myers <joseph@codesourcery.com> *//* { dg-do run { xfail { ia64-*-hpux* && lp64 } } } *//* { dg-options "" } */#include <float.h>#include "fp-int-convert.h"intmain (void){  TEST_I_F(TItype, UTItype, float, FLT_MANT_DIG);  TEST_I_F(TItype, UTItype, double, DBL_MANT_DIG);  /* Disable the long double tests when using IBM Extended Doubles.     They have variable precision, but constants calculated by gcc's     real.c assume fixed precision.  */#if DBL_MANT_DIG != LDBL_MANT_DIG  && LDBL_MANT_DIG != 106  TEST_I_F(TItype, UTItype, long double, LDBL_MANT_DIG);#endif  exit (0);}

⌨️ 快捷键说明

复制代码Ctrl + C
搜索代码Ctrl + F
全屏模式F11
增大字号Ctrl + =
减小字号Ctrl + -
显示快捷键?